LIGHT IS SEEN FROM SUPER-EARTH FOR THE FIRST TIME.

Before we get started: no, the "Super-Earth" is not a habitable world. The planet I'm talking about is 55 Cancri e, which was discovered in 2004. Its only called a super-Earth because of its size and mass. It's mass is about 8 times greater than Earths and its about double in width.

Light was detected from 55 Cancri e for the first time this past week, and was detected by NASA's Spitzer Space Telescope. Many astronomers are calling this a historic achievement because it's the first time light from a rocky super-earth has been seen. Because the side that faces the parent star reaches up to 1,726 degrees Celsius (3,140 degrees Fahrenheit) water cannot exist on the planet in a state that most humans are common with. It can however exist in a "supercritical fluid" state which can be thought of as a gas in a liquid state. Sometimes this happens on Earth in steam engines.

Spitzer found light from another planet in 2005, but it was a gas giant in an orbit extremely close to it's parent star. The alien solar system 55 Cancri e is a part of includes another four exoplanets. The star the exoplanets circle around is called 55 Cancri and the system is found in the constellation Cancer.

SUPERMOON THIS SATURDAY

You should look at the moon on the 5th of May. More precisely, at 11:34 P.M. Eastern Time. Why? Well the moon is set to be about 16 times brighter and bigger than usual. This is because it will be at it's closest to the Earth. This point on the moon's orbit is called the perigee. The moon is 221,802 miles away from the Earth at this point, and while it may seem like that is a lot of miles, it's almost nothing on the astronomical scale. 

So, the moon reaches it's perigee at 11:34 P.M.. What else is special about Saturday? Well, the moon is also going to be full. So the view will be even more spectacular. An interesting thing that will happen is that the full moon will happen at around 11:34 P.M. while the perigee is reached at 11:35 P.M., which rarely happens.

NEW PARTICLE DISCOVERED BY THE LHC

Scientists at CERN have discovered a new particle through the use of the Large Hadron Collider. They announced last Friday that the new particle is actually called "neutral Xi_b^star" and is in fact a baryon.

The baryon is made up of three quarks and exists for an incredibly short amount of time. "It lives for less time than you or me can imagine," Carlos Lourenco, a lead scientist at CERN said in an interview. The particle can only exist on earth in the LHC, and sometimes in space. An example of when it could exist in space is when a huge cosmic ray hits the moon.

ANTARCTIC ICE IS MELTING FROM BELOW

NASA has found that the western shores of Antarctica have been melting from below instead of above. This is because the ocean is getting warmer and warmer faster than the air above it. In the video below, please note that the shelf thickness (how thick the ice is) is indicated by color. Red would be thick (550 meters or thicker) and blue would be thinner (200 meters or thinner).


The information in this graphic was gathered by NASA's ICESat, which was launched in January of 2003. It stand for Ice, Cloud, and land Elevation. It is located in orbit around Antarctica, and scientists collected data on how ice was melting from October of 2005 to 2008. They concluded that nearly half of all ice shelves were melting from below.

MYSTERIOUS OBJECTS DEFORMING SATURN'S RING

Saturn has always had a ring that was the odd ball, and this ring is called the F ring. Now, it seems that half a mile objects are punching holes through this ring, leaving some pretty cool trails that scientists describe as "mini jets". Now, scientists have an idea of what might be causing these weird smears on Saturn's F ring. Here's what Carl Murray, a Cassini imaging team member based at London's Queen Mary University had to say about the ring:"I think the F ring is Saturn's weirdest ring, and these latest Cassini results go to show how the F ring is even more dynamic than we ever thought. These findings show us that the F ring region is like a bustling zoo of objects from a half mile in size to moons like Prometheus a hundred miles in size, creating a spectacular show."

From this we can conclude that these objects are "snowballs" left by Prometheus and Saturn's other moon that keeps the F ring in check, Pandora. These "snowballs" are created when the moons pass through the ring. The snowballs are created and then also collide with the F ring. POLAR BEAR ANCESTRY DECODED

We used to believe that polar bears branched off from brown bears about 150,000 years ago to be able to live  on the Arctic Sea. This hypothesis might soon be disputed, for new DNA evidence says differently.

The new study looked at the mitochondrial DNA of black bears, polar bears, and brown bears. They found that brown and polar bears have a common ancestor and split up about 600,000 years ago. During the study it was found that polar bears are much more genetically unique than previously thought.

The new find does not only challenge the idea that polar bears branched off from brown bears, but also that polar bears adapted quickly to their new environment. One thing the study confirms is that polar bears have made it through warm periods on Earth in the past.
